Music & Videos DDG – Hard On Myself (Official Music Video) R Dra September 22, 2023 Post Views: 147 Continue Reading Previous Imagine Dragons – Children of the Sky (a Starfield song) [Official Music Video]Next Lil Tecca – Dead or Alive (Official Video) More Stories Music & Videos MEOVV – ‘TOXIC’ M/V R Dra November 18, 2024 Music & Videos TAEYEON 태연 ‘Letter To Myself’ MV R Dra November 18, 2024 Music & Videos XG – HOWLING (Official Music Video) R Dra November 8, 2024